Manitou Group, which is comprised of Manitou, Gehl and Mustang, will celebrate the manufacturing of its 500,000th machine.

Manitou Americas will announce the celebration of the Manitou Group's 500,000th machine at various summer trade shows; Empire Farm Days in Seneca Falls, NY; Ag Progress Days in Pennsylvania Furnace, PA; and Wisconsin Farm Tech Days in Sun Prairie, WI.
For the occasion, the "500,001" and "500,002" customized machines will be on display. The Gehl "500,001" RT175 GEN:2 track loader and the Mustang "500,002" 1900R skid loader have been painted with a reverse color scheme in honor of the half-million milestone.
The Manitou Group designs, manufactures, distributes and supports equipment for the construction, agriculture and industrial markets. It specializes in telescopic handlers, all-terrain forklifts, skid steers, track loaders, articulated loaders, semi-industrial and industrial masted forklifts, access platforms, truck-mounted forklifts and attachments.
